Medical Definition of serial section. : any of a series of sections cut in sequence by a microtome from a prepared specimen (as of tissue)

Preparation method and application of tissue slice for observing temporal-spatial distribution of early embryo development in vivo

InactiveCN102944456AObservation continuityEasy to observe continuityPreparing sample for investigationCooking & bakingFluorescence
The invention discloses a preparation method and an application of a tissue slice for observing temporal-spatial distribution of early embryo development in vivo. The preparation method comprises the following steps that 4% paraformaldehyde fixing, upward gradient ethanol dehydration, wax dipping, embedding, serial section, baking, dewaxing and downward gradient ethanol rehydration are performed in sequence on oviducts or uterine tissues which contain mice embryos in every period, and finally, after haematoxylin-eosin staining is performed on the tissues in the slice, neutral gum is used for sealing the slice, or after immunofluorescence histochemical staining is performed on the slice, a fluorescence resistant quenching sealing agent is used for sealing the slice. The tissue slice disclosed by the invention can be used for manufacturing a map of early mice embryo development and detecting the expression of Crb3 in the mice embryos in every period of development in vivo. The preparation method has the advantages that positions of all organs in the embryos can be relatively fixed, so that the position change of embryo cells in a genital tract and the continuity of embryo development can be conveniently observed, the structure is clear, and the tissue slice is convenient to store.

Treatment method of potato type non-grain starch fuel ethanol distiller solution

The invention relates to a treatment method of potato type non-grain starch fuel ethanol distiller solution. The method comprises the following steps: waste distiller solution is pretreated simply and adjusted by an adjusting tank and then enters an anaerobic treatment system, wherein the first-stage anaerobic treatment adopts well mixed high temperature anaerobic fermentation and the second-stage anaerobic treatment adopts a medium temperature UASB anaerobic reactor; different microorganisms are utilized to degrade the organic pollutants in the wastewater and generate biogas; a cooling device, a setting tank and an air flotation device are arranged between the two anaerobic reactors to ensure the concentration of the well mixed high temperature anaerobic sludge; the two-stage anaerobic effluent enter two serial sections of oxidation ditches to further remove the organic matter; different denitrification technologies are selected according to ammonia nitrogen indexes to obtain stable denitrification effect; and finally flocculation precipitation and physicochemical treatment are performed, and the obtained water meets the standards and is discharged. The method of the invention has low cost, stable technology and high biogas extraction efficiency of wastewater; and the obtained sludge is used as organic fertilizer and the effluent meet the grade A standard of the integrated wastewater discharge standard (GB8978-1996) for the alcohol industry.

Cone beam CT (computed tomography) fast reconstruction method based on rectangular bounding box

The invention discloses a cone beam CT (computed tomography) fast reconstruction method based on a rectangular bounding box. The method comprises the following steps of: carrying out cone beam CT circular scanning on a test piece, acquiring a set of projection images and cutting the projection images into a set of square projection images with the side length of E pixels; calculating the size of the rectangular bounding box of the test piece in a reconstruction space, and respectively calculating logarithm images of the square projection images; carrying out filtering treatment in an FDK (Feldkamp) algorithm on the logarithm images; distributing a single-precision floating-point memory space from a computer according to the size of the rectangular bounding box, and carrying out cone beam CT reconstruction calculation by adopting a single-instruction multi-data technology according to a Z-line prior reconstruction algorithm; and storing a reconstruction result as serial section images on the X direction, the Y direction or the Z direction according to a coordinate system thereof. The invention effectively improves the reconstruction speed of the cone beam CT and reduces the requirements of the reconstruction algorithm on the memory size.

Porcelain bushing type direct current field PLC/RI capacitor

The invention discloses a porcelain bushing type direct current field PLC/RI capacitor. The capacitor comprises a pedestal and a high-voltage electric porcelain bushing which is vertically fixed on the pedestal, wherein a plurality of capacitor elements which are immersed in a liquid insulating medium and connected with each other in series are arranged in the high-voltage electric porcelain bushing; the plurality of capacitor elements which are connected in series are averagely divided into several serial sections with as many capacitor elements as each other; each serial section is connected with a resistor with the same resistance in parallel; the upper end of the high-voltage electric porcelain bushing is provided with a sealing cover which is provided with an external oil-filled expander; the upper end of the external oil-filled expander is provided with a sealing cover and a high-voltage wiring board; and the lower end of the pedestal is provided with a low-voltage connecting terminal. A porcelain bushing type structure is adopted by the porcelain bushing type direct current field PLC/RI capacitor of the invention, namely the high-voltage electric porcelain bushing is adopted as a product shell, and the high-voltage electric porcelain bushing is also used as a supporting insulator, so that the cost for additionally arranging the supporting insulator is saved. By rational space arrangement, the area occupied by the entire capacitor is greatly reduced.

Manufacture method of frozen section for observing handeliodendron bodinieri seed oil body

The present invention discloses a manufacture method of a frozen section for observing handeliodendron bodinieri seed oil body, which comprises the following steps: (1) handeliodendron bodinieri seedsare taken and the middle parts of two cotyledons are cut respectively; (2) embedding: pre-cooling is performed; after the temperature is reduced to -30+/-2 DEG C, an embedding agent is dripped and refrigeration is performed for 40+/3 minutes; (3) serial section is performed and the thickness of the section is 15+/-2 mum; (4) the cut tissue is adhered to a glass slide; the part of the glass slideadhered to the cut tissue is immersed in water; and the tissue section goes away from the glass slide by shaking and is expanded in water; (5) the section expanded in water is dragged onto the glass slide; a dye solution is added dropwise and a cover glass covers on the section; then the frozen section for observing the handeliodendron bodinieri seed oil body is obtained. With the frozen section obtained by the method of the invention, the handeliodendron bodinieri seed oil body is clearly visible under a microscope; the integrity of the cotyledonstorage cell is good; cells basically do not overlap; and the section has a superior integrity, is extended and not easy to curl.
